Lil' Kim is a Lil' Miffed About Her Portrayal in New Biggie Film
Biggie Smalls was not only Lil' Kim's mentor, but they were also romantically involved (on-and-off) for quite some time. Although Kim's character has quite a bit of screen time, Lil' Kim claims that she's extremely unhappy about how her relationship with the notorious rapper was portrayed by the screenwriters.She claims, "Even though my relationship with Big was at times very difficult and complicated (as with most relationships we have all experienced at one time or another), it was also genuine and built on great admiration and love for each other. Regardless of the many lies in the movie and false portrayal of me to help carry a story line through, I will still continue to carry his legacy through my hard work and music."
A rep for Kim has also released a statement that claims the producers involved were "more concerned about painting [Kim] as a 'character' to create a more interesting story line instead of a person with talent, self-respect and who was able to achieve her own career success through hard work."
Despite the diva's discontentment, the screenwriter says that he believes the actress playing Kim "did a great job" and that "people are going to be a lot more sympathetic towards [Lil' Kim] after seeing the movie."

Murder At Lil' Kim's Birthday Party
Sad news coming out of NYC today. A woman was killed at the birthday party of rapper Lil' Kim in Midtown Manhattan on Sunday.The body of a 24-year-old Queens, N.Y., woman named Ingrid Rivera was found on the roof of the Midtown karaoke club, Spotlight Live, where Kim's birthday was held. She was reportedly hit with a blunt object and left on the rooftop for dead. So sad.
The police said that the murder victim was last seen on Sunday night and was reported missing on Tuesday. No comment has been released from Kim's camp.
Bad Girl Rapper Gets Busted

Rap songstress Lil Kim was caught last night driving her Lamborghini around the neighborhood without tags or a valid driver's license. As she was going to get some gas, cops saw the car and detained Kim, until her lawyer was able to come pick her up and drive the car home. It is not known at this time whether or not Kim will be charged for driving without a license.
